Bears cut 4-time Pro Bowl DL Ratliff, sign Hood

CHICAGO -- The Chicago Bears released veteran defensive lineman Jeremiah Ratliff and signed defensive lineman Ziggy Hood, the team announced Thursday.

"We felt moving forward without Jeremiah was in the best interest of our team," Bears general manager Ryan Pace said in a prepared statement. "We appreciate his contributions and wish him well."

Ratliff's tenure in Chicago unraveled on Wednesday. Ratliff, dressed in Bears warmups clothes, and Pace were observed having an animated conversation in front of Halas Hall around 11:30 a.m. CT while the rest of the team was on the practice field.
